About the University of East Anglia
The University of East Anglia (UEA) is a prestigious public research university located in the historic city of Norwich, England. Established in 1963, the university has grown into one of the UK’s most respected institutions, known for its high-quality teaching, innovative research, and strong emphasis on student experience.
Set on a scenic and self-contained campus, UEA offers a perfect blend of academic excellence and a supportive learning environment. The university is widely recognized for its interdisciplinary approach, encouraging students to explore ideas across different subjects and develop critical thinking skills that are highly valued in today’s global job market.

UEA is a member of the Norwich Research Park, one of Europe’s largest research hubs. The university is globally recognized for its research in:
Climate change and environmental science
Health and biological sciences
Its research is often impactful and contributes to global policy and innovation.
